In today’s gig economy, freelancing has become a viable career option for many individuals seeking flexibility and independence. However, to thrive in this competitive landscape, freelancers must develop a set of essential skills that will help them stand out and succeed.

1. Time Management

Effective time management is crucial for freelancers, as they often juggle multiple projects and deadlines. Here are some strategies to enhance time management skills:

  • Set clear goals and deadlines for each project.
  • Use tools like calendars and task management apps to organize your schedule.
  • Prioritize tasks based on urgency and importance.
  • Establish a routine to maintain consistency in your work.

2. Communication Skills

Strong communication skills are essential for freelancers to effectively convey their ideas and collaborate with clients. Consider the following:

  • Practice active listening to understand client needs.
  • Be clear and concise in your written and verbal communication.
  • Use professional language and tone in all interactions.
  • Provide regular updates to clients to keep them informed.

3. Marketing and Self-Promotion

Freelancers must market themselves effectively to attract clients. Here are some marketing strategies:

  • Create a professional website showcasing your portfolio.
  • Utilize social media platforms to connect with potential clients.
  • Network with other professionals in your industry.
  • Offer valuable content, such as blogs or webinars, to demonstrate expertise.

4. Financial Management

Managing finances is a critical skill for freelancers, as they often face irregular income. Consider these financial management tips:

  • Set a budget to track income and expenses.
  • Save a portion of income for taxes and emergencies.
  • Use accounting software to simplify invoicing and bookkeeping.
  • Understand your pricing strategy to ensure profitability.

5. Adaptability and Problem-Solving

The freelance landscape is constantly changing, requiring freelancers to be adaptable and resourceful. Here are ways to enhance these skills:

  • Stay informed about industry trends and changes.
  • Be open to feedback and willing to adjust your approach.
  • Develop critical thinking skills to analyze problems effectively.
  • Practice brainstorming solutions for various challenges you may encounter.

6. Technical Skills

In a digital world, freelancers must possess relevant technical skills. Depending on your field, these may include:

  • Proficiency in industry-specific software and tools.
  • Basic understanding of graphic design or web development.
  • Familiarity with digital marketing techniques.
  • Ability to use collaboration tools for remote work.

7. Client Management

Building and maintaining strong relationships with clients is vital for long-term success. Here are tips for effective client management:

  • Set clear expectations from the start of each project.
  • Be responsive to client inquiries and concerns.
  • Seek feedback to improve your services.
  • Acknowledge and celebrate client milestones and successes.

8. Networking Skills

Networking is essential for freelancers to build connections and find new opportunities. Here are ways to enhance networking skills:

  • Attend industry events and conferences.
  • Join online forums and groups related to your field.
  • Leverage LinkedIn to connect with other professionals.
  • Offer to help others in your network to build goodwill.

9. Negotiation Skills

Freelancers often need to negotiate terms with clients. Developing negotiation skills can lead to better contracts and pay. Consider the following:

  • Research industry standards for pricing and deliverables.
  • Practice articulating your value to clients.
  • Be prepared to walk away if terms are not favorable.
  • Stay calm and professional during negotiations.

10. Continuous Learning

The freelance landscape is ever-evolving, making continuous learning vital. Here are ways to commit to lifelong learning:

  • Enroll in online courses to enhance your skills.
  • Read industry-related books and articles regularly.
  • Attend workshops and webinars to stay updated.
  • Join professional organizations for access to resources.

By mastering these essential skills, freelancers can improve their chances of success and create a sustainable career in the dynamic world of freelancing.
